Jamie Oliver Chunky Winter Vegetable Soup Recipe

  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: 4 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Vegetables:

  • 2 stalks celery
  • 3 carrots
  • 2 large leeks
  • 2 cloves garlic
  • 1 sprig fresh rosemary
  • 75 grams (2.6 ounces) baby spinach or kale
  • 100 grams (3.5 ounces) frozen peas

Proteins:

  • 2 rashers smoked streaky bacon
  • 1 x 400 grams (14 ounces) tin of borlotti or cannellini beans

Liquids and Oils:

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 liter (4.2 cups) organic vegetable or chicken stock

Instructions

  1. Carefully trim and finely slice the celery, peel and chop the carrots, and wash and chop the leeks into uniform pieces. Mince the garlic and chop the rosemary with precision.
  2. Slice the bacon into small, bite-sized pieces to ensure even cooking and distribution throughout the dish.
  3. Heat 1 tablespoon (15 milliliters) of olive oil in a large pan over medium heat. Introduce the rosemary and bacon, allowing them to sizzle and develop a golden-brown hue.
  4. Gently add the prepared celery, carrots, leeks, and minced garlic to the aromatic bacon mixture. Reduce heat to low and let the vegetables soften, stirring intermittently for approximately 15 minutes.
  5. Pour the beans with their liquid and 2 cups (480 milliliters) of vegetable or chicken stock into the pan. Elevate the heat to bring the mixture to a gentle boil, then reduce to a simmer for 30 minutes.
  6. Monitor the liquid level, adding more stock or water if the mixture appears too thick or dry during cooking.
  7. Incorporate fresh spinach or kale and frozen peas into the simmering mixture. Cook for an additional 3 minutes until the greens become vibrant and tender.
  8. Taste the final preparation and adjust seasoning with salt and freshly ground black pepper to enhance the overall flavor profile.
